Will small streamers get DMCA?
Will Twitch DMCA Small Streamers? Yes, Twitch will DMCA small streamers if they break the law and play copyrighted music without permission through the proper channels. To avoid this, streamers need to play royalty-free music on their streams.
Is Twitch DMCA still a thing?
Following a long battle involving DMCA strikes, Twitch has officially reached an agreement with the National Music Publishers’ Association to help curb accidental punishments against its content creators.
How do I turn on Twitch alerts?
In the mobile app, from the streamers channel page, when a streamer is live, tap the gear icon in the video player. Scroll down to the Broadcaster Options section turn on Live Notifications.
